These findings highlight the significant role of tissue mechanics in regulating immune responses. Understanding this could lead to novel therapeutic targets for treating chronic inflammatory conditions and preventing excessive coagulation.
We explored how mechanical forces—specifically cyclic stretch and substrate stiffness—affect NETosis. We found that increased stretch and stiffness amplify NETosis and sensitivity to NET-inducing agents via activation of Calpain, PI3K, and FAK pathways.

Shear stress increases intracellular calcium levels in neutrophils and this process is mediated by Piezo1. Activation of Piezo1 in response to shear stress mediates calpain activity and cytoskeleton remodeling, which triggers NETosis. @Ying25505110 @DrQuinn4realz @ManijehKh2020.
